科研课题推动下的教学实验研究——以"机械振动测试实验"为例

随着现代工程技术的不断发展,振动实验教学在新工科背景下得以不断发展与进步.机械振动测试实验课程通过理论讲解、案例分析等方式,使学生深入理解机械振动的基本原理和振动测试方法.进而通过实际操作振动测试仪器,使学生掌握振动传感器的安装、调试和使用方法,学会使用数据采集系统与分析软件进行数据处理和分析,培养学生的实际操作能力.在科研课题与实验教学的融合中,采用严谨的科研与创新思维指导实验教学工作,引导学生以科研的视角开展实验研究,为其在工程领域的创新发展奠定坚实的基础.
Research on Teaching Experiments Driven by Scientific Research Projects—Taking"Mechanical Vibration Test Experiment"as an Example
With the continuous development of modern engineering technology,vibration experiment teaching has been continuously developed and improved under the background of new engineering.The course of Mechani-cal Vibration Test Experiment enables students to deeply understand the basic principles and testing methods of me-chanical vibration through theoretical explanation,case analysis and other methods.Then through practically operat-ing vibration test instruments,it enables students to master the installation,debugging and use methods of vibration sensors,and learn to use the data acquisition system and analysis software for data processing and analysis,so as to cultivate their practical operation ability.In the integration of scientific research projects and experimental teaching,it adopts rigorous scientific research and innovative thinking to guide experimental teaching,and guides students to carry out experimental research from a perspective of scientific research,so as to lay a solid foundation for their in-novation and development in the engineering field.
